  • Lot# : 515 Peru

    1788/1858c.: The collection of pre-stamps covers or fronts (134 items) from Colonial period to Republic, from ABANCAY to TRUXILLO, with FRANCA mark in red attributed to Acari, ten items from AREQUIPA incl. markings in red, black or blue and fine cover with VAPOR and oval AREQUIPA / N. 2½ in black, Colonial ARICA straight line in red and further marks in blue or brown, AYACUCHO covers (4), items from Bolivar, Caxamarca (3), Callao (4), CAMANA in red and black, CHACHAPS in red, black and blue, first type CHALA in red, Colonial CUZCO in red and 1804 printed Postal Notice, HUANUCO in red, HUAURA in black, HUARAZ in red and black, IQUIQUE and VAPOR on cover in blue, JAUJA in red (3), MOQUEGUA in red (2), MOYOB.A in brown, NASCA  in red, items from ORURO, OTUSCO, PAITA in red (incl. a Consignee's letter from London), PASCO in red and black and oval '2R' rate mark, PATAZ in red, PATIVILCA, PISCO, PIURA in red, PUNO in red and black, SANTA in red and in black, SICUANI and SUPE in red, TACNA in red and blue, Colonial TARMA in red and TRUJILLO handstamps in red and in black. Condition generally fine to very fine. An exceptional collection with viewing recommended.
